Respect For All Life
Our Respect for all Life Mission Team is hosting A Day of Adoration, Wednesday, Oct. 15, from 8 a.m.-8 p.m., at the Church in Oakland. This day of Adoration includes prayers for the protection of the unborn. Come as you are and join us as we adore our Lord in the Blessed Sacrament for the protection of the unborn and an end to abortions. Mass with Father Bill Keown will be celebrated at noon, and we will pray the Rosary for Life at 10 a.m. (Joyful Mysteries), 3 p.m. (Sorrowful Mysteries), and 7:30 p.m. (Glorious Mysteries)
Gifts for Life: The Respect for All Life Team is collecting items for the babies and mothers of The James Isaac House. If you would like to help with this ongoing outreach, you’ll find a rack next to the basement door inside the Oakland church to place items such as diapers, wipes, lotions, infant clothing, and even gifts for the new moms, when the church is open. Our team members will gather and deliver items to the James Isaac House on a regular basis. We will soon arrange for a drop-off location at the Lake Center, as well. “Unlocking the Mystery of the Bible”
October 7- May 5; First Tuesdays Only from 6-7:30 p.m., at the Parish Center. All are invited to join us for a free video and discussion series of “Unlocking the Mystery of the Bible” by Jeff Cavins. This series helps us get the big picture of the Bible by showing how its fourteen narrative books tell the complete story from Adam and Eve to Christ and the Church. Nancy Ensor will lead us through our discussions with a 30 minute video at each session. No book or homework required. Free snacks! Sponsored by our Evangelization Mission Team.
